Part 1: Describe the power transmission process, from generation to distribution. -Describe the components of an electrical power system. -Identify types of power lines, standard voltages, and components of high-voltage transmission lines (HVTL). -Describe the construction of a transmission line, galloping lines, corona effect, insulator pollution, and lightning strikes. -Explain transmission system stability in regards to power transfer, power flow division, and transfer impedance. Part 2: Develop expressions for resistance, inductance and capacitance of high-voltage power transmission lines and determine the equivalent circuit of a three-phase transmission line. -List the types of conductors used in power transmission line. -Develop the expression for the inductance and capacitance of a simple, single-phase, two wire transmission line composed of solid round conductors. -Deduce the expression for the inductance and capacitance of a simple, single-phase composite (stranded) conductor line. -Derive the expression for the inductance and capacitance of three-phase lines having symmetrically and asymmetrically spacing and for bundled conductors. -Discuss the effect of earth on the capacitance of three-phase transmission lines. -Derive the short transmission lines models and medium transmission lines models.
